After entering your settings, select Next. The following screen appears.

This screen allows the user to configure the LAN interface IP address, subnet mask and DHCP server. If the user would like this router to
assign dynamic IP address, DNS server and default gateways to other LAN devices, select the button Enable DHCP server and enter the
Start and End IP addresses and DHCP leased time.

To configure a secondary IP address for the LAN port, tick the checkbox shown.

7:

Click Next to continue. To enable the wireless function, select the radio button (as shown), input a new SSID (if desired) and click
Next.

8:

Click Next to display the WAN Setup-Summary screen that presents the entire configuration summary. Click Save/Reboot if the
settings are correct. Click Back if you wish to modify the settings.

9:

After clicking Save/Reboot, the router will save the configuration to flash memory and reboot. The Web UI will not respond until
the system is brought up again. After the system is up, the Web UI will refresh to the Home screen automatically. The router is
ready for operation when the LED indicators display as described in Section 1.3
